org.mule.module.cxf.support
Class MuleSecurityManagerValidator

java.lang.Object
  extended by org.mule.module.cxf.support.MuleSecurityManagerValidator
All Implemented Interfaces:
org.apache.ws.security.validate.Validator

public class MuleSecurityManagerValidator
extends Object
implements org.apache.ws.security.validate.Validator

Integrates mule spring security with CXF ws-security


Constructor Summary
MuleSecurityManagerValidator()
           
 
Method Summary
 void setSecurityManager(SecurityManager securityManager)
           
 org.apache.ws.security.validate.Credential validate(org.apache.ws.security.validate.Credential credential, org.apache.ws.security.handler.RequestData data)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

MuleSecurityManagerValidator

public MuleSecurityManagerValidator()
Method Detail

validate

public org.apache.ws.security.validate.Credential validate(org.apache.ws.security.validate.Credential credential,
                                                           org.apache.ws.security.handler.RequestData data)
                                                    throws org.apache.ws.security.WSSecurityException
Specified by:
validate in interface org.apache.ws.security.validate.Validator
Throws:
org.apache.ws.security.WSSecurityException

setSecurityManager

public void setSecurityManager(SecurityManager securityManager)


Copyright © 2003-2012 MuleSoft, Inc.. All Rights Reserved.